Commit Message

Dave Hansen June 3, 2016, 12:19 a.m. UTC
From: Dave Hansen <dave.hansen@linux.intel.com>

Use the new INTEL_FAM6_* macros for intel_idle.c.  Also fix up
some of the macros to be consistent with how some of the
intel_idle code refers to the model.

There's on oddity here: model 0x1F is uniquely referred to here
and nowhere else that I could find.  0x1E/0x1F are just spelled
out as "Intel Core i7 and i5 Processors" in the SDM or as "Intel
processors based on the Nehalem, Westmere microarchitectures" in
the RDPMC section.  Comments between tables 19-19 and 19-20 in
the SDM seem to point to 0x1F being some kind of Westmere, so
let's call it "WESTMERE2".

Len Brown June 17, 2016, 2:39 a.m. UTC | #1
On Thu, Jun 2, 2016 at 8:19 PM, Dave Hansen <dave@sr71.net> wrote:
>
> From: Dave Hansen <dave.hansen@linux.intel.com>
>
> Use the new INTEL_FAM6_* macros for intel_idle.c.  Also fix up
> some of the macros to be consistent with how some of the
> intel_idle code refers to the model.
>
> There's on oddity here: model 0x1F is uniquely referred to here
> and nowhere else that I could find.  0x1E/0x1F are just spelled
> out as "Intel Core i7 and i5 Processors" in the SDM or as "Intel
> processors based on the Nehalem, Westmere microarchitectures" in
> the RDPMC section.  Comments between tables 19-19 and 19-20 in
> the SDM seem to point to 0x1F being some kind of Westmere, so
> let's call it "WESTMERE2".
>

>  #define INTEL_FAM6_NEHALEM_EP          0x1A
>  #define INTEL_FAM6_NEHALEM_EX          0x2E
>  #define INTEL_FAM6_WESTMERE            0x25
> +#define INTEL_FAM6_WESTMERE2           0x1F

Model 0x1F, like 1A and 1E is a Nehalem, not a Westmere.
This can be seen in the current SDM section 35.5.

For the historians, I believe that the name "Havendale" was originally
associated with that model# -- though I don't know if that binding persisted.

My NHM desktop is a 1A, though, not a 1F.
